Engineering Physics is the 244th most popular major in the country with 994 degrees awarded in 2020-2021. In 2019-2020, engineering physics graduates who were awarded their degree in 2017-2019, earned an average of $53,863 and had an average of $25,114 in loans still to pay off.

Across Minnesota, there were 11 engineering physics gra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ively.

For this year’s “Schools Highly Focused on Engineering Physics Major in Minnesota” ranking, we looked at 4 colleges that offer a degree in engineering physics. This a ranking of the schools where the largest percentage of students has enrolled in engineering physics.
